I just did a calibration check on the P3 and it was right on using the XG3 at
-107 DBM

with the K3 connected to a dummy load my measured noise floor is -133 DBM (
hard to get close as it is fuzzy)         the strength of the birdies is at
- 125 DBM.  

they seem to have peaks every 140 KHZ  up and down the band,  

 my lowest noise floor in the city  is right at -125 at the best.
so in the city this is not a big thing as you can just detect them if you
know where to look for them.

but I was planing to use the K3 + KPA500 for contesting in rare Grid squares
in remote location out in the boonies, which would be away from city noise,
and I am sure the noise floor would be at least -130 dbm  
then this would be a problem...

maybe they can come up with a fix for it?
